So, KochiKame - The Movie: Save the Kachidoki Bridge! really dives into the misadventures of Kankichi Ryotsu, and it’s got this quirky charm that really captures the essence of the series. The pacing is pretty brisk, packed with gags and the typical chaos that comes with Ryotsu's antics. It's comedic, but there's a warmth in how they portray camaraderie amongst the police force. The practical effects aren't over-the-top, but they add a nice touch, especially in some of the chase scenes. Shingo Katori brings his character to life with this effortless goofiness that feels just right. It’s not a straightforward narrative, more like a series of connected sketches, which adds to its distinctiveness.
